Modified Accrual Accounting

This accounting method recognizes revenues when they become available and measurable and expenses when incurred, blending elements of both cash and accrual accounting.

Accrual Accounting

An accounting method where revenue and expenses are recorded when they are earned or incurred, regardless of when the cash is received or paid.
